COLORADO SPRINGS, Colorado – Former Cougar basketball All-American Jennifer Hamson has been selected as one of 27 women's basketball players to participate in the USA Basketball Women's National Team training camp, May 4-6 at UNLV's Mendenhall Center in Las Vegas.

She is among three players who are participating in their first ever USA Basketball National Training Camp. From the group, 12 players will be selected to compete in the 2016 Olympic Games, held Aug. 5-21 in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il.

Hamson is currently in her first season with the WNBA's Los Angeles Sparks.
